  1. Extract text from ZIP archive files | Documenta...

    To extract files from ZIP archives getContainer method is used. This method returns the collection of ContainerItem objects. Zip Entry can contain the following metadata: Name Description date The time and date at which the file indicated by the Zip Entry was last modified. crc The 32-bit CRC (Cyclic Redundancy Check) on the contents of the Zip Entry. These metadata refer to a container element itself, not a document.   8. Basic Usage | Documentation

    GroupDocs.Watermark library provides the ability to manipulate different watermark types such as TextWatermark, ImageWatermark. These watermarks could be added to documents, updated, removed, or searched inside already watermarked documents. Our product also provides information about document type and structure - file type, size, page count, etc. and generates document page previews based on provided options.
